PUBLIC MEETING - Free Joe Glenton! - Troops Home From Afghanistan!. 2pm Saturday 28th November, Manchester Town Hall. Albert Square. M60 2LA
Lance Corporal Joe Glenton is now in military prison. He faces charges which carry a ten year sentence.
His 'crime' was to say what most in the country believe - that the troops should come home from Afghanistan.

Joe was using the very human rights we were told the war was being fought for, when he spoke out. He refuses to go back to Afghanistan, he led the Stop the War march last month.
The Army have detained Joe to try and stop him speaking out.
'Gagged' soldier Joe Glenton's mum and his wife Claire GlentonĀ will speak in Manchester
'You hear generals and politicians saying we should get out of Afghanistan every day, but when Joe says it they lock him up. Well they have gagged Joe, but they will not gag me, and they will not gag his wife from speaking out either', Joe's mother Sue Glenton told us last week.
